How Water Damage Reconstruction Actually Works
Water damage reconstruction is not just about fixing a leaky pipe or drying out a room. It’s a complex process that needs specialized equipment and expertise to ensure your home is safe and healthy. Our team follows a strict protocol to prevent further damage, contamination, and costly repairs.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We’ll assess the damage and contain the affected area to prevent further water intrusion.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to identify moisture levels, detect hidden leaks, and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ll extract the standing water using powerful pumps and vacuums, reducing the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ry out your home, including dehumidifiers and air movers, to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ll clean and sanitize all surfaces, including walls, floors, and ceilings, to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 5: Reconstruction and Repair
We’ll repair and reconstruct any damaged are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ings, to ensure your home is safe and secure.

Water Damage Reconstruction Cost In Euless, TX
The cost of water damage reconstruction in Euless, TX var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on our experience and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ions |
| Water Extraction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Amount of water, complexity of extraction |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$1,000 – $3,000 | Type of surfaces, extent of cleaning needed |
| Reconstruction and Rep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age, type of repairs needed |
| Final Inspection and Certification | $500 – $1,500 | Complexity of inspection, type of certification needed |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to ensure you get the best value for your money.
